  9. I want to start by saying I am someone who has played/coached Bball in the nky area over the last 20 years. I have also spent extensive time with multiple D1 teams in this time. This said college "signings" in this nky area and honestly the state of ky is laughable. If players and parents alike would stop waiting for their "star player" to be seen by colleges the better off they would be. Recruiting is purely marketing and sales. I talk to college coaches weekly who ask me about players. The first thing they ask...? Got film or highlights for him. Parents and players alike reading this make a demo tape asap. Now the fun part.... Send the tape and a resume (just like applying for a job) to any and every school you would ever consider going to or playing for. Granted this takes a lot of effort. Many people will read this and laugh. As someone who has used this practice I have seen both full ride scholarships for division 2 and 1 athletes in this area. I say all of this not to discredit the area but to encourage. Many talented ball players in nky settle for lesser schools bc the aren't recruited. Get yourself recruited! Good luck to all!
